Do Crocs Come in Big Kid Sizes? The Answer!

Yes, absolutely! Crocs are available in big kid sizes. This is excellent news for parents of children who have outgrown the toddler and little kid sizes. Crocs understands that kids of all ages love their comfortable footwear, and they cater to a wide range of feet.

Big Kid Size Ranges

Crocs big kid sizes typically start around a size 1 or 2 and go up to a size 6 or 7. The exact range can vary slightly depending on the specific style of Crocs. This range generally covers the elementary school years and beyond, ensuring that your child can continue to enjoy Crocs as they grow.

Choosing the Right Size: A Step-by-Step Guide

Getting the right size is crucial for ensuring your child’s comfort and preventing blisters or other issues.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you choose the perfect fit:

1. Measure Your Child’s Feet

The most accurate way to determine your child’s shoe size is to measure their feet. Do this at the end of the day when their feet are most swollen. Here’s how:

  1. Gather Supplies: You’ll need a piece of paper, a pen or pencil, and a ruler or measuring tape.
  2. Place Foot on Paper: Have your child stand on the paper with their heel against a wall or flat surface.
  3. Trace the Foot: Trace around your child’s foot, making sure the pen or pencil is perpendicular to the paper.
  4. Measure Length and Width: Use the ruler or measuring tape to measure the length (from the heel to the longest toe) and the width (at the widest part of the foot) of the traced foot.
  5. Repeat for Both Feet: Measure both feet, as one foot is often slightly larger than the other. Use the measurements of the larger foot for sizing.

4. Leave Room for Growth

Children’s feet grow quickly, so it’s wise to leave a little room for growth. A general guideline is to add about half an inch to your child’s foot measurement. This will give them enough space to move their toes comfortably and allow the shoes to last longer.

5. Try Before You Buy (if Possible)

If you’re shopping in a physical store, have your child try on the Crocs to ensure a proper fit. They should be able to wiggle their toes comfortably, and there should be a small amount of space between their longest toe and the end of the shoe. If you’re buying online and can’t try them on, read reviews and consider ordering two sizes to compare, returning the pair that doesn’t fit.
